Research Focus

Dr Kevin Reuther is the academic director of the S-E-A-M research Institute, aiming at the continious development of the systemic entrepreneurship activity method (S-E-A-M) to enable evidence-based entrepreneurship research through the structured collection and analysis of entrepreneurship process data. He is also a senior research fellow at the Chair of Innovation Management and Innovation Economics at Leipzig University and the Fraunhofer Institute for International Management and Knowledge Economy IMW, where he is responsible for evidence-based entrepreneurship research. Previously, he was responsible for the topics of entrepreneurship, innovation and research methodology as a deputy professor at the Westsächsische Hochschule Zwickau. His main research interests lay in the fields of evidence-based entrepreneurship research, entrepreneurship activity systems, systemic innovation research as well as interdependencies in innovation systems.
